Transaction 7a7c04c905dc86eb96b51c9a764fbfb58b0d6c8a5c1b0ab63f5f85e0b04ca73c

32 Input
1 Outputs
  • 7a7c04c905dc86eb96b51c9a764fbfb58b0d6c8a5c1b0ab63f5f85e0b04ca73c:0
  • value  5019183
    address  3KvLmvAfYkk7XqintQVdPXg8RCALsePJZj